    They say your wedding day is meant to be flawless, but mine turned into a disaster the moment my groom decided humiliating me was funny. What my brother did afterward left every guest completely stunned.

    Today, my life is peaceful. It really is.

    My days are filled with laughter, school runs, and bedtime stories. Still, there’s something from 13 years ago I can never forget. It was supposed to be the happiest day of my life.

    My wedding day.

    Sometimes I think about how everything might have been different if that moment hadn’t happened. But then I remember what followed, and I’m actually grateful it did.

    Let me take you back to when I was 26.

    That’s when I met Ed.

    We crossed paths at a small downtown coffee shop where I used to spend my lunch breaks writing. Back then, I worked as a marketing assistant, and those 30 minutes were my escape from routine.

    Ed showed up every day, always ordering the same caramel latte.

    What stood out wasn’t just his habit—it was how he kept trying to guess my order before I even spoke.

    “Let me guess,” he’d say confidently, “vanilla chai with extra foam?”

    He was wrong every single time… but he never stopped trying.

    Until one day, he got it right.

    “Iced coffee, two sugars, a splash of cream,” he said proudly.

    I laughed. “How did you know?”

    “I’ve been paying attention,” he admitted with a grin. “Can I get it for you?”

    I had no idea that simple moment would eventually lead me to the aisle.

    Soon, we were sitting together at the same little table, laughing over pastries.

    He told me about his job in IT, his love for classic films, and how he’d been working up the courage to talk to me for weeks.

    From there, everything felt natural.

    Ed was thoughtful in the ways that mattered. Instead of expensive gifts, he brought me single sunflowers because he knew I loved them. He planned simple picnics, remembered my favorite foods, and showed up with ice cream when I had bad days.

    For two years, he made me feel seen.

    Then he proposed.

    We were walking along a pier at sunset when he suddenly stopped, dropped to one knee, and asked me to marry him.

    I didn’t hesitate.

    I said yes.

    A few weeks later, I introduced him to my family—my mom and my older brother, Ryan.

    Ryan had always been protective. After our dad passed away, he stepped into that role without being asked. He wasn’t just my brother—he was my guardian.

    That night, I watched him closely study Ed.

    But by the end of dinner, Ryan gave me a small nod.

    That meant everything.

    The wedding planning flew by.

    We chose a beautiful venue, decorated with white roses and warm lights. Everything was perfect.

    And on the big day, I felt like I was floating.

    The ceremony was everything I dreamed of. My mom cried. Ryan beamed with pride. Ed looked at me like I was his whole world.

    For a moment, everything felt exactly right.

    Then came the cake.

    I had imagined this moment for weeks—us cutting it together, sharing a laugh, feeding each other gently.

    Instead, Ed gave me a mischievous look.

    “Ready?” he asked.

    “Ready,” I smiled.

    We cut the cake… and suddenly, he grabbed the back of my head and shoved my face straight into it.

    The room gasped.

    Frosting covered my face, my hair, my dress. My makeup was ruined instantly. I couldn’t even see.

    I stood there, frozen.

    Humiliated.

    This was supposed to be our moment.

    And he turned it into a joke.

    Worse, he was laughing.

    That’s when I saw Ryan move.

    He stood up, his expression dark with anger.

    Before anyone could react, he walked straight across the room, grabbed Ed, and shoved his face hard into the cake.

    But he didn’t stop there.

    He pushed him deeper, covering his face, his hair, his expensive suit in frosting.

    The room fell silent.

    “This isn’t funny,” Ryan said firmly. “You just humiliated your wife in front of everyone.”

    Ed struggled to stand, covered in cake.

    Ryan looked at him coldly.
    “How does it feel? Because that’s exactly what you just did to her.”

    Then he turned to me, his voice softer.

    “Think carefully if you want to spend your life with someone who treats you like this.”

    Ed blamed Ryan, saying he ruined the wedding.

    Then he walked out.

    The reception continued without the groom.

    That night, I sat alone, still wearing my ruined dress, wondering if my marriage was already over.

    The next morning, Ed came back.

    He looked exhausted.

    He dropped to his knees and apologized.

    “For the first time, I understood how badly I hurt you,” he said. “I thought it was funny, but it wasn’t. I humiliated you. I’m so sorry.”

    And I believed him.

    I forgave him—but not instantly.

    Ryan, on the other hand, didn’t trust him so easily. He kept watching, making sure that lesson stayed with him.

    Now, 13 years later, I can say I’m truly happy.

    We have two beautiful children, and Ed has never forgotten that moment.

    He knows someone will always stand up for me.

    And that’s why I’m sharing this story today.

    Because my brother didn’t just protect me that day—

    he reminded everyone what respect really looks like.

    Some heroes don’t wear capes.

    Mine wore a suit…

    and wasn’t afraid to make a scene when it mattered.
